Factors Influencing Cost
Installing new windows in a house in Albany, OR, involves various factors that can influence overall project costs. Understanding typical considerations can help homeowners compare options and plan accordingly. This overview provides a neutral summary of key aspects involved in house window installation projects.
- Materials: Options include vinyl, wood, or aluminum frames, each with different durability and maintenance requirements suitable for local climate conditions.
- Size and Scope: Project scope varies from replacing a single window to installing multiple units across different rooms, affecting overall complexity.
- Labor Complexity: Factors such as window type, accessibility, and existing structures influence the labor effort required for installation.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Albany may require permits for certain window replacements, especially for larger or structural changes.
- Additional Options: Extras such as energy-efficient glass, custom sizes, or decorative features can impact project scope and cost.
